No real difference in 06 and 07 that I know of. Some 07s (option package maybe) have an aux jack in the center console. I am adding an aux to my 06 for about $65, so no real big deal. Now if you go with the 08, not sure when it happened, but get the revised heads that utilize a one piece spark plug from the factory. This wouldn't influence me either way though. I would get the year 06/07/08 that was the best deal when considering mileage, looks, color of your choice, etc and price. Older car can give you more money to fix it up the way you want your stang to look and perform.

I waited a couple of months before ordering mine to get a couple of new options for '07. I prefer the black cloth top to the standard top. The heated seats mean I can drop the top when it's a little cooler without the wife complaining.
 
I'd go for an 08/09 with the revised heads if you plan on keeping it and ever want to change the spark plugs :nice: You also stand a better chance of having some factory warranty left in case any issues arise during your first year of ownership.

See if this helps you on the Ipod/Iphone connection (from my 2006GT with shaker500)

Depends on where you want the control to be. For shaker500 control, expect to pay $165-$200 depending on brand. For Ipod/Iphone/Mp3 player control, expect to pay about $80 including the cable - plus it charges the Ipod/Iphone.
